You can also customize the feature by choosing which apps are allowed to run in the background when Batter Saver is on. ![]() The Battery saver feature can be set to turn on automatically or can be turned on manually. The Battery saver feature helps to conserve your computer battery by limiting the background activities and adjusting the hardware settings.
